>> HTTP/2 support in Apache is still considered experimental by
>> upstream[1], so we didn't enable it in the LTS under security team
>> guidance[2]. Support is available in nginx though, as that went stable
>> in time.
>>
>> We intend to enable HTTP/2 support for Apache in an SRU as soon as
>> upstream consider it stable and no longer experimental.
>>
>> The concern is that both implementation and configuration directives may
>> change, and we can't realistically follow this in the LTS timeframe
>> without breaking production users. This in turn would compromise
>> security since upstream security patches will no longer apply and be
>> tough to backport.
>>
>> A weighing up of regression risk to users will need to influence any
>> future SRU decision to enable support, of course.
